Texas Persimmon

Diospyros texana

Description:

Immature fruit. It darkens to black in late summer or fall. When fully ripe it is very sweet, though it has several large seeds. When green it is astringent.

Habitat:

Habitat yard landscaped with plants chosen to attract wildlife.

Notes:

It is an important wildlife food.
